
QuantHealth
QuantHealth uses AI to simulate clinical trials for pharmaceutical companies, having modeled over 600 trials across 30 disease areas with up to 90% prediction accuracy. The company works with 12 of the top 20 pharma firms and has raised $62M.

About
QuantHealth sells AI software that helps drugmakers test clinical trial designs virtually before running real studies. Pharmaceutical and biotech clients use it to compare thousands of protocol variations, aiming to reduce trial failures and speed up drug development.
The company has simulated trials in 30 therapeutic areas and claims 90% accuracy in predicting outcomes. Its $62M Series B in 2026 suggests strong investor confidence in its approach to de-risking clinical research.
